Education

Educated at Shevchenko State Art School[9], an organization[27], in Ukraine[28], founded in 1937[29] and National Academy of Visual Arts and Architecture[10], an academy[30], in Ukraine[31], founded in 1917[32]. Studied under Petro Herasymovych Drachenko[25], a painter[33], 1913–1996[34], of Russian Empire[35], awarded the Order of the Patriotic War, 2nd class[36]; Viktor Puzyrkov[26], a painter[37], 1918–1999[38], of Soviet Union[39], awarded the Stalin Prize[40]; and Oleksii Shovkunenko[41], a painter[42], 1884–1974[43], of Russian Empire[44], awarded the People's Painter of the USSR[45].
